Overview

Shao Cong Sun is affiliated with The University of Texas MD Anderson Cancer Center in the United States. Their research primarily focuses on immunology and microbiology, medicine, as well as biochemistry, genetics, and molecular biology. The scientist's work spans several subfields, including immunology, molecular biology, oncology, cancer research, and mechanical engineering.

The main topics explored in their publications include:

  • Immune Cell Function and Interaction
  • NF-κB Signaling Pathways
  • Ubiquitin and proteasome pathways
  • Interferon and immune responses
  • Advanced machining processes and optimization
  • Immune cells in cancer
  • Autophagy in Disease and Therapy
